Get a Quote2019-10-1 · Boiler Design Software is a tool designed for thermodynamic calculations of fossil fuel fired boilers. The program calculates the heat transfer in fossil fuel (oil, gas, biomass, waste derived fuel) fired fire-tube and water-tube steam, hot water and waste heat boilers of arbitrary geometry operated at arbitrary operating conditions with pressure up to 1800bar/2610psi.

Get a Quote2018-8-5 · Summary • The firetube boiler is a versatile package suitable for a plethora of applications including heating and process • Typical size range is 100 –2500 HP • Pressures to 350# • Construction follows ASME code Sections I & IV and includes close 3rd party inspections • There are both dryback & wetback horizontal firetubes with each having advantages and disadvantages
